What Do Methane/Landfill Gas Collection System Operator Do?

Occupation Description Direct daily operations, maintenance, or repair of landfill gas projects, including maintenance of daily logs, determination of service priorities, and compliance with reporting requirements.

Methane Gas Collection System Operator Responsibilities

  • Maintain records for landfill gas collection systems to demonstrate compliance with safety and environmental laws, regulations, or policies.
  • Monitor and control liquid or gas landfill extraction systems.
  • Implement landfill operational and emergency procedures.
  • Evaluate landfill gas collection service requirements to meet operational plans and productivity goals.
  • Track volume and weight of landfill waste.
  • Oversee gas collection landfill operations, including leachate and gas management or rail operations.

Is There Going to be Demand for Methane/Landfill Gas Collection System Operators?

In 2016, there was an estimated number of 170,600 jobs in the United States for Methane/Landfill Gas Collection System Operator. There is little to no growth in job opportunities for Methane/Landfill Gas Collection System Operator. The BLS estimates 11,600 yearly job openings in this field.

Tools & Technologies Used by Methane/Landfill Gas Collection System Operators

Although they’re not necessarily needed for all jobs, the following technologies are used by many Methane/Landfill Gas Collection System Operators:

  • Microsoft Excel
  • Microsoft Word
  • Microsoft Office
  • Web browser software
  • Email software
  • SAP
  • Computerized maintenance management system CMMS
  • Distributed control system DCS
  • Employee scheduling software
  • WorkTech MAXIMO
  • Landfill gas analysis software
  • Landtec System Software LFG Pro
